The CSR is one of Australia's most remote treks.
Suggest that you go with a group as a tag along.
You will need to ensure that you carry enough fuel for at least 1100 Km of soft sand driving, suggest 200 Lts + minimum, as resupply can be sporadic.
Also food and
water for 3 weeks, working on 5L per person per day, not including washing
water or emergency radiator supplies.
Remote area comms are essential,
HF radio and or satphone. These can be hired from various
places if you don't wish to purchase them for the trip.
You will need to carry vehicle spares, eg: belts, radiator hoses, spare shocks, 2 spare
wheels, and maybe a spare case. Tools, compressor and tyre repair equipment, assortment of fuses and electrical stuff. Tyres should have 75% tread or more.
Camping and cooking equipment.
Make sure your vehicle is
well serviced by a reputable person before departure and make sure that they are advised that the vehicle is going to a remote area.
